Buck Broke is the father to Trigger Broke and Susie Broke, as well as the widower of Mary Lu Broke. He is the brother to Flat Broke, and uncle to Skip Broke and Ruby Broke. So far, not much is known about him since is was not mentioned in either the The Sims, or the The Sims 2. He works at the graveyard but dislikes his job.
It is rumoured that he has a connection with Buck Oakley from The Sims 2: Pets (console) as they are very similar characters in looks, personality, and social status.
